AJO CELEBRATES!

The greater Ajo community of Ajo, Why, Lukeville, Sonoyta (MX) and the Tohono O’odham Nation proudly announces Saturday, March 14, 2015 as the date for the second Authentically Ajo Regional Food Festival. The Food Festival takes place in Ajo’s colorful historic plaza as a joyful celebration of Ajo’s garden movement and the cultural diversity of Ajo area foods. Organized by the Ajo Regional Food Partnership, the festival is a not-for-profit PARTY where we have fun with food!
